Cuyahoga County Court of Common Pleas Juvenile Division Juvenile Justice Center 9300 Quincy Avenue Cleveland, OH 44106 216-443-8400Cleveland Police arrests and investigations made up the largest share — 46 % — of cases in the Cuyahoga County Common Pleas Court from 2016 through 2021. The Cuyahoga County Sheriff's office, which operates the county jail and has jurisdiction countywide, had the next highest number of cases.

MEDINA, Ohio -- Medina County Common Pleas Court Judge Joyce Kimbler has announced that she is running for re-election and says she is eager to have another ...There is a court of common pleas in each of Ohio's 88 counties. Specific courts of common pleas may be divided into separate divisions by the General Assembly, including general, domestic relations, juvenile and probate divisions. The Re-Entry Court (REEC) was established to address the needs of offenders transitioning from prison back into the community. REEC was started Cuyahoga County Common Pleas Court in 2007 and was funded through the Office of Criminal Justice Services. Expungements. Expungement in Ohio is a legal process provided under Section 2953 of the Ohio Revised Code. This allows a person to have all references to a prior criminal conviction cleared and their court file sealed.
